Post by: Milbo on November 21, 2013, 12:10:41 PM
The easiest way for you is maybe

Install again the core and aio over your installation, to be sure to have the correct files now. Be sure that akeeba enhanced installer and similar is disabled. Then just download the provided category model and copy it to the path /administrator/components/com_virtuemart/models. Then you maybe should installl your template again, to be sure to have the correct files.

I have no clue what you already changed there and of course the fix is meant for unmodified files.
